A Modern University Focused on Career Success
The University of Hertfordshire is a forward-thinking institution recognised for its strong emphasis on employability, innovation, and industry engagement. Established in 1952, the University has built a reputation for delivering career-focused education across business, finance, marketing, and related disciplines.
Located just outside London, it provides students with access to global career opportunities while benefiting from a supportive campus environment and strong employer links. Its teaching combines academic knowledge with practical application, ensuring graduates are well-prepared for the workplace.
Key Statistics
- 90.4% of graduates in employment or further study within 15 months
- 72.2% of graduates in highly skilled employment
- Top 50 UK university (Guardian University Guide 2026)
- Top 25% in the UK for research impact (REF 2021)
- 90% of research impact rated ‘outstanding’ or ‘very considerable’

ATHE Progression Routes to the University of Hertfordshire
Undergraduate Entry:
Accounting / Accounting & Finance (L3–L5 Accounting)
Business Administration / Business Management / Business & Marketing (L3–L5 Business & Management)
Advertising & Digital Marketing (L3 Business / Business & Management)
English Language Requirement
- IELTS 6.0 overall (minimum 5.5 in each band), or equivalent English language qualification
